The Impact of Celebrity Gossip on Our Society
Celebrity gossip shapes our cultural narrative in profound ways. It acts as a mirror reflecting societal values, aspirations, and even anxieties. Fans often project their dreams onto stars, turning these public figures into symbols of success or cautionary tales.
This fascination creates a shared language among audiences. Conversations about celebrities become social currency, allowing people to connect over common interests. Yet this connection can blur the line between admiration and obsession.
Additionally, celebrity gossip serves as an escape for many. It diverts attention from daily struggles and personal challenges by immersing individuals in the glamorous yet tumultuous lives of stars.
However, it also cultivates unrealistic expectations regarding beauty and lifestyle. Constant exposure to curated images can lead individuals to feel inadequate or dissatisfied with their own lives.
In a sense, celebrity gossip acts both as entertainment and commentary on human nature itself.
Ethical Considerations in Reporting on Celebrities
When it comes to celebrity gossip, ethics often take a backseat. The allure of scandal and drama can overshadow the responsibility that comes with reporting.
Journalists should prioritize truth over sensationalism. Misleading headlines can create false narratives, damaging reputations in an instant. Accuracy is crucial; celebrities are people too, deserving respect.
Privacy is another key issue. Stars live under public scrutiny but still have the right to personal space. Intruding on their lives can lead to harmful consequences both personally and professionally.
Moreover, media outlets must consider the impact of their stories on audiences. Gossip may entertain but perpetuating negativity serves no one well. It’s essential for reporters to balance intrigue with integrity while adhering to ethical guidelines that protect individuals involved.
Responsible reporting fosters trust between journalists and readers while promoting a healthier conversation surrounding celebrity culture.

Behind-the-Scenes: How Do Tabloids Get Their Information?
Tabloids thrive on the thrill of secrets and scandal. But how do they gather such juicy tidbits? It often starts with insiders—those close to celebrities who spill the beans for a price.
Publicists may also play a role, strategically leaking information to shape narratives or boost their clients’ image. This dance between truth and fiction keeps readers hungry for more.
Then there’s social media, an open book where stars share their lives in real-time. A simple tweet or Instagram post can spark headlines before you know it.
Paparazzi are another key player; they’re always lurking around corners, ready to snap that perfect shot. Their relentless pursuit means nothing is off-limits.
Public appearances and events provide fertile ground for rumor mills to churn out speculative stories based on body language alone. The world watches closely as each piece fits into the larger puzzle of celebrity life.

The Dark Side of Celebrity Gossip: Its Effect on Mental Health and Personal Lives
The allure of celebrity gossip often masks a darker reality. The constant scrutiny can strain the mental health of famous individuals, turning their lives into open books filled with judgment.
Stars are not just public figures; they are human beings. The pressure to maintain an image while grappling with personal issues can be overwhelming. Many celebrities find themselves battling anxiety and depression due to relentless media attention.
Relationships also bear the brunt of this invasive culture. Friends and family may feel the effects as tabloids dissect even private moments. Trust becomes fragile when every detail is up for analysis.
Moreover, social media amplifies this phenomenon, allowing fans to weigh in on everything from wardrobe choices to romantic entanglements. This instant feedback loop can lead stars to feel isolated or misunderstood, trapped by a persona crafted for public consumption.
